Boss
Inlay (uncertain)
75-29-337
From: Iran | Hasanlu
Curatorial Section: Near Eastern
| Object Number | 75-29-337 |
| Current Location | Collections Storage |
| Provenience | Iran | Hasanlu |
| Archaeology Area | V22W(4)[15]/18A |
| Period | Hasanlu Period IV |
| Date Made | 1000-800 BCE |
| Section | Near Eastern |
| Materials | Bone |
| Description | Round bone boss, one surface conical; other surface is trimmed and edged, possibly to serve as an inlay. |
| Credit Line | The Hasanlu Project; Robert H. Dyson Jr., 1975 |
